安卓 Facebook SDK : generate release key hash
全部标签 我正在制作一个应用程序,用户可以在其中根据GPS位置设置闹钟。我只想在任何时候激活1个闹钟。所以,当用户设置第二个闹钟时,我想取消第一个闹钟的通知(然后为第二个闹钟设置新的通知)。现在,我的通知继续堆积(因为我无法删除它们,所以它们都处于Activity状态)。这是我尝试删除警报和通知的代码://StopthelocationalarmactivityIntentintentAlarmService_delete=newIntent(v.getContext(),AlarmService.class);stopService(intentAlarmService_delete);//I
所以我的目标是水平翻转图像,然后将其绘制在Canvas上。目前我正在使用canvas.scale(-1,1),它可以有效地工作并水平绘制图像,但是它也会与x轴值发生关系,在比例之前,x位置将是150,之后我必须切换它到-150以在同一位置呈现。我的问题是,我怎样才能使x值在两种情况下都为150,而不必在缩放后调整x位置?有没有一种更有效的方法可以在不影响性能的情况下做到这一点? 最佳答案 我知道这个问题很老了,但我碰巧遇到了同样的问题。在我的情况下,在扩展ImageButton的类上绘图时,我不得不翻转Canvas。幸运的是,这个特
我在android源代码中找到了示例插件。假设我可以使用示例编写一个插件,我如何让我的模拟器运行我编写的插件?我需要重新编译源代码吗?如果是,那是怎么做到的?谢谢:) 最佳答案 BrowserPlugin示例是如何编写实际浏览器插件的示例。例如Flash播放器它侧重于用C/C++native代码编写的插件,然后在Android用户导航到具有匹配标签的页面时调用。根据我对Android应用程序开发的经验和观察,这不是开发本地Android应用程序(例如:游戏、通信程序等)的推荐方法回应Chadic:无需重新编译模拟器即可部署浏览器插件
我想在我的Android应用程序中试用GoogleAnalytics。一切正常,但在我的分析页面上没有显示访问者。我可以在LogCat中看到它发送了数据,我从示例中复制了4个标签。tracker.trackEvent("Clicks",//Category"Button",//Action"clicked",//Label77);//Value我还在它后面添加了dispatch。我现在等了3-4小时,但仍然没有访客,在启用了互联网的模拟器中试了一下。 最佳答案 仔细检查您输入的唯一key是否正确。GoogleAnalyticsTra
我需要通过su获得root访问权限以午餐TcpDump二进制文件(我正在研究一种android嗅探器)。我使用这段代码:try{Processprocess=Runtime.getRuntime().exec("su");DataOutputStreamos=newDataOutputStream(process.getOutputStream());os=newDataOutputStream(process.getOutputStream());os.writeBytes("/data/local/tcpdump-arm-c10-s0-w/data/local/out.txt\n"
我收到如下异常。谁能帮帮我?06-1611:32:48.237:ERROR/AndroidRuntime(9223):java.lang.IllegalStateException:Thespecifiedchildalreadyhasaparent.YoumustcallremoveView()onthechild'sparentfirst.06-1611:32:48.237:ERROR/AndroidRuntime(9223):atandroid.view.ViewGroup.addViewInner(ViewGroup.java:1970)06-1611:32:48.237:ER
我知道不应该使用SMS提供程序,但我想知道称为“状态”的字段的可能值是什么(其他一些字段也是如此,但我最感兴趣的是状态)以及当我这样做时这些值的含义:UriuriSms=Uri.parse("content://sms/inbox");Cursorc=context.getContentResolver().query(uriSms,null,null,null,null);//fieldsretrieved0:_id1:thread_id2:address3:person4:date5:protocol6:read7:status8:type9:reply_path_present1
问题就是我要说的全部内容。我需要知道如何处理androidNDK中的特殊按键,如back、menu等。我正在使用Cocos2dX,所以如果你能给我一个Cocos2dX特定的答案,那会很棒。 最佳答案 在cocos2dx中,每个CCLayer都有以下方法,可以重写这些方法来为其添加功能:classCC_DLLCCKeypadDelegate{public://ThebackkeyclickedvirtualvoidkeyBackClicked(){}//Themenukeyclicked.onlyavialbleonwophone&a
我必须实现一个Android2.2应用程序,它应该能够上传从它的图库中选择的图像,但是我没有配备Android2.2的设备所以我必须在模拟器上测试它,但我不知道如何复制图像从我电脑的硬盘到模拟器的sd卡。我发现了很多类似类型的帖子,但没有一个对我有用。所以我希望你的帮助谢谢! 最佳答案 如果您使用的是DDMS工具(无论是否在Eclipse下),您只需将图像拖放到选定的文件夹即可。SDCard文件夹在mnt文件夹下。已编辑DDMS可以在...\android-sdk\tools下找到。在Eclipse中,您可以通过单击Window>O
如何在Activity中使用双击事件?双击事件或长按方法有效(尽管该方法被覆盖)我刚刚在这些方法中的每一个中都添加了toast消息,但没有结果!你能帮忙吗? 最佳答案 进行双击的最简单方法是使用GestureDetector检测它。“技巧”是确保将Activity的onTouchEvent委托(delegate)给GestureDetector的onTouchEvent:importandroid.app.Activity;importandroid.os.Bundle;importandroid.view.GestureDetec